highReviewed `aws-lc/crypto/bio/errno.c`, a small C helper that decides whether `BIO` operations should retry based on `errno` values like `EWOULDBLOCK`, `EINTR`, and `EAGAIN`. I found no concrete malicious or supply-chain indicators in this file: no install hooks, network or exfiltration behavior, credential access, dynamic code loading, obfuscation, persistence, or hidden subprocess execution. Reviewed `aws-lc/third_party/jitterentropy/jitterentropy-timer.h`, which only declares timer-related APIs and provides small inline stubs when `JENT_CONF_ENABLE_INTERNAL_TIMER` is unset. I found no concrete indicators of install hooks, network or exfiltration behavior, credential access, dynamic code loading, obfuscation, persistence, or other supply-chain compromise in this file. Reviewed `aws-lc/ssl/test/test_state.h`, a C++ test-support header that defines `TestState` plus serialization/deserialization and clock/session helpers for SSL test harnesses. I found no concrete indicators of install-time execution, network/exfiltration, credential access, dynamic code loading, obfuscation, or persistence in this file. Reviewed `aws-lc/third_party/s2n-bignum/x86_att/p521/bignum_demont_p521.S`, a small x86-64 assembly routine that performs a fixed P-521 Montgomery-domain rotation/conversion and ABI shims for Windows vs. System V. I found no concrete indicators of install-time execution, network or exfiltration, credential access, dynamic code loading, obfuscation, or persistence behavior in this file. Reviewed `aws-lc/crypto/fipsmodule/modes/ofb.c`, a small AES OFB-mode implementation that performs in-place block/XOR processing with assertions and no apparent side effects. I checked for install hooks, network or exfiltration behavior, credential access, dynamic code loading, obfuscation, and persistence tampering, and found no concrete malicious or supply-chain indicators.
